Related Catalog Natural Products >> Steroids Research Areas >> Others Target Human Endogenous Metabolite In Vitro 7-Dehydrocholesterol is a biosynthetic precursor of cholesterol and vitamin D3. 7-Dehydrocholesterol is present in relatively high concentration in skin where it is converted to pre-vitamin D3 upon UV irradiation and where it is also exposed to exogenous radical sources and oxygen[1]. References [1]. Xu L, et al. Oxysterols from free radical chain oxidation of 7-dehydrocholesterol: product and mechanistic studies. J Am Chem Soc. 2010 Feb 24;132(7):2222-32.
